Alabama Historical Radio Society is a non-profit organization which promotes knowledge about and appreciation of vintage radio equipment and broadcasting. The group meets weekly at the Alabama Power East Jefferson Service Center at 9837 Parkway East and operates the Don Kresge Memorial Museum, a showcase of historic radio equipment and memorabilia in the Alabama Power Building at 600 18th Street North in downtown Birmingham.

The society was founded in June 1989 by Don Kresge.
